Effectiveness and persistence of mirabegron as a first ‐line treatment in patients with overactive bladder in real‐life practice

ConclusionsMirabegron is an effective first ‐line therapy for OAB, but has a persistence rate of 39.4% at 12 months. Patients with severe baseline OAB symptoms tended to require add‐on therapy during follow‐up.
